How would you describe your experience as an NYU Wagner student?

My experience as an NYU Wagner student was tremendously valuable. Because of the combined NYU undergraduate-graduate dual degree program, I took a variety of courses – such as financial management and human resources – for a fraction of the cost. I also completed my credits through evening classes, which enabled me to design a schedule that worked for me.

How did your Wagner experience prepare you professionally for what you are doing today?

Wagner taught me how to communicate in every form and equipped me with the skills I needed to present ideas in a way that is easy for audiences to understand. As an alumnus of Sarah Kaufman’s Emerging Leaders in Transportation program, I also developed leadership skills and learned about policy from top transportation and management professionals. Through the connections I made during that program, I was also able to organize the installation of a piano at the Port Authority Bus Terminal to help make commutes more pleasant.
